< fx-350TL>
This calculator is powered by single G13 Type (LR44) but-
ton battery.

• Replacing the Battery

Dim figures on the display of the calculator indicate that
battery power is low. Continued use of the calculator
when the battery is low can result in improper operation.
Replace the battery as soon as possible when display
figures become dim.

• To replace the battery

1 Press

i

to turn power off.

2 Remove the two screws that hold

the battery cover in place and
then remove the battery cover.

3 Remove the old battery.

4 Wipe off the side of new battery

with a dry, soft cloth. Load it into
the unit with the positive

k

side

facing up (so you can see it).

5 Replace the battery cover and

secure it in place with the two
screws.

6 Use a thin, pointed object to

press the P button. Be sure not
to skip this step.

7 Press

L

to turn power on.

• Auto Power Off

Calculator power automatically turns off if you do not per-
form any operation for about six minutes. When this hap-
pens, press

L

( fx-85W/ fx-85WA / fx-300W :

5

) to turn

power back on.
